About This Landmark

Located in Bigfork, Montana, Wayfarers Campground offers a serene escape by the crystal-clear waters of Flathead Lake, the largest natural freshwater lake in the western United States. Nestled amid lush greenery, this destination is a haven for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ts alike. The campground provides stunning lake views with the majestic Swan and Mission Mountains as a backdrop, creating an unforgettable natural canvas. Visitors can enjoy a tranquil atmosphere along with amenities that make camping comfortable and enjoyable. The shoreline is dotted with smooth stones and lined with pine trees, offering perfect spots for picnics and relaxation. Flathead Lake is renowned for its excellent fishing opportunities, and it's common to see boats dotting the waters. The area boasts a rich tapestry of wildlife, with bald eagles and ospreys frequently seen soaring overhead. The region also holds cultural significance, with the Flathead Indian Reservation nearby, adding a layer of historical depth to the visit. Established as part of the Montana State Parks system, Wayfarers provides a blend of natural beauty and recreational activities, making it a standout destination for those seeking both adventure and tranquility.

Adventure Guide to Wayfarers Campground

  1. Hiking Trails

    • What Makes It Special: Explore miles of trails that wind through stunning landscapes. Enjoy views of Flathead Lake and the surrounding mountains.
    • Key Features: There are trails for all skill levels, offering adventures for beginners and experienced hikers alike.
    • Visitor Tips: Spring and fall are the best times to visit to avoid summer crowds. Bring sturdy shoes and plenty of water.
  2. Boating and Fishing on Flathead Lake

    • What Makes It Special: Perfect for water sports, the lake supports a vibrant fish population, including trout and whitefish.
    • Key Features: Public boat ramps and rental services are available nearby.
    • Visitor Tips: Early morning and late afternoon are ideal for fishing. Don't forget your sunscreen and fishing license.
  3. Camping Under the Stars

    • What Makes It Special: Experience the magic of sleeping under the vast Montana sky, filled with stars.
    • Key Features: Equipped with picnic tables, fire pits, and modern restrooms.
    • Visitor Tips: Make reservations early, especially during peak summer months. Bring warm clothing as temperatures can drop significantly at night.
